引言
学习编程语言是现代技能的重要组成部分,它不仅能够提升个人竞争力,还能助力于解决各种复杂问题。为了更高效地掌握编程语言,精选预习资源是至关重要的第一步。本文将详细介绍如何通过预习资源来为编程学习打下坚实的基础。
一、选择合适的编程语言
1.1 了解编程语言的应用场景
在开始预习之前,首先要明确自己学习的编程语言是为了什么目的。常见的编程语言包括但不限于:
- Python:适用于数据分析、人工智能、网页开发等领域。
- Java:广泛应用于企业级应用、安卓应用开发。
- C++:适合系统编程、游戏开发等。
- JavaScript:主要用于网页开发。
1.2 根据个人兴趣和职业规划选择
选择编程语言时,应考虑个人兴趣和未来职业规划。例如,如果对人工智能领域感兴趣,那么Python可能是最佳选择。
二、预习资源的选择
2.1 教程和书籍
- 在线教程:如Codecademy、freeCodeCamp等,提供互动式学习体验。
- 经典书籍:如《Python编程:从入门到实践》、《JavaScript高级程序设计》等。
2.2 视频教程
- YouTube频道:许多编程大牛会分享自己的教学视频。
- 在线教育平台:如Coursera、Udemy等,提供系统化的课程。
2.3 实践项目
- GitHub:可以找到许多开源项目,通过阅读代码来学习。
- 个人项目:通过实际动手编写项目,加深对语言的理解。
三、预习步骤
3.1 基础语法学习
- 熟悉编程语言的基本语法结构,如变量、数据类型、运算符等。
- 通过编写简单的代码来巩固基础。
3.2 编程思想
- 理解编程的基本思想,如面向对象编程、函数式编程等。
- 学习如何将实际问题转化为编程问题。
3.3 实践与调试
- 动手实践,通过编写代码来解决实际问题。
- 学习调试技巧,提高代码质量。
四、学习资源推荐
4.1 Python
- 书籍:《Python编程:从入门到实践》
- 在线教程:Codecademy的Python课程
- 实践项目:爬虫、数据分析项目
4.2 Java
- 书籍:《Java核心技术》
- 在线教程:Oracle官方Java教程
- 实践项目:Android应用开发
4.3 JavaScript
- 书籍:《JavaScript高级程序设计》
- 在线教程:freeCodeCamp的JavaScript课程
- 实践项目:网页开发项目
五、总结
通过精心挑选的预习资源,可以有效地为学习编程语言做好准备。掌握编程语言是一个循序渐进的过程,持续的实践和不断的学习是关键。希望本文能为您提供有益的指导,祝您学习顺利!
